How Much is Rafael Nadal Worth? Net Worth & Career Earnings

Rafael Nadal is one of the most marketable athletes in global sports, and his net worth reflects two decades of dominance on clay and consistent excellence across all surfaces. Understanding how much Rafael Nadal is worth involves looking at prize money, endorsements, business ventures, and long-term brand value.

Beyond his Grand Slam titles, Nadal’s financial profile is shaped by his disciplined career choices, strategic partnerships, and sustained relevance in an evolving tennis landscape. The following breakdown helps clarify the key factors that shape his estimated net worth and annual earnings.

Category Details Estimated Value Notes
Career Prize Money Tournament winnings across ATP and Grand Slams Over $130 million Among the highest in tennis history
Annual Endorsement Income Sponsorships and brand partnerships per year $20–30 million Contracts with Nike, Babolat, Kia, and others
Business & Investment Ventures Ownership stakes and advisory roles Contributes to net worth growth Includes restaurants and equity partnerships
Estimated Net Worth Overall financial position as of recent reports $200–220 million Varies based on investments and market conditions

Earnings From Prize Money And Titles

Nadal’s competitive success directly shaped his financial foundation, with Grand Slam victories driving substantial bonuses and appearance fees. His movement on the professional tour consistently translated into increased ranking points and higher prize payouts.

Over his career, he has earned well over $130 million in official prize money, a reflection of deep runs at the majors and consistent semifinal and finals appearances. This portion of his wealth represents one of the most significant components of how much Rafael Nadal is worth from his time on court.

Nadal’s Endorsement And Spons Portfolio

Off-court partnerships have played a crucial role in building his long-term net worth, with international brands seeking his discipline and sportsmanship. His endorsement deals provide stable annual income and elevate his market value far beyond match fees.

Major partnerships with Nike for apparel and footwear, Babolat for racquets, and Kia for automotive promotions form the backbone of his sponsorship income. These deals, alongside watch, nutrition, and financial services agreements, contribute roughly $20–30 million per year to his earnings profile.

Business Investments And Long-Term Assets

Nadal has diversified his portfolio by investing in restaurants, real estate, and tech partnerships, turning his fame into sustainable business growth. These ventures not only generate revenue but also strengthen his brand beyond the tennis court.

By taking ownership stakes in select startups and hospitality projects, he has created additional streams of income that compound over time. This business-focused approach explains how his net worth has grown steadily even as his tournament appearances have decreased.
